Home
North Bay
Business Lookup
Contact Lookup
Reverse Phone Lookup
Login
Join
Castle Glass Mirror
705-476-5410
1745 Seymour St
North Bay
ON P1A 0C6
Business Category
Store Fronts
Castle Glass Mirror QR Card
Rate & Review Castle Glass Mirror
Your Rating
Review Title
Your Review
Update Castle Glass Mirror and add logo, business hours, images and more.
Update this Listing
Share this business
Castle Glass Mirror, Phone Number 705-476-5410, +1 7054765410, Address 1745 Seymour St, City North Bay ON, Postal Code P1A 0C6 Canada
Download vCard or use the Castle Glass Mirror QR Code. Castle Glass Mirror area of business is Store Fronts.
Castle Glass Mirror vCard
Download vCard
People in North Bay
D Gauthier
705-497-3554
1281 Cassells St, North Bay
S Certossi
705-495-3458
98 Harris Dr, North Bay
J Grant
705-494-6177
29 Pollard Ave, North Bay
J Nixon
705-474-9567
459 Bunting Dr, North Bay
B Grant
705-494-9764
29 Pollard Ave, North Bay
L Goulias
705-753-9612
49 Jocko Point Rd, North Bay
M E Mihalech
705-476-2425
161 Lindsay St, North Bay
M Laframboise
705-495-0292
145 Janice St, North Bay
L B Green
705-472-4670
47 Nightingale Dr, North Bay
R Steele
705-475-0600
55 Nancy Dr, North Bay
Gordon Hewitt
705-476-2650
550 Wallace Rd, North Bay
L Rouillard
705-495-2613
288 Champlain St, North Bay
A Lario
705-476-6861
139 Champlain St, North Bay
K Crocker
705-476-0553
381 Greenhill Ave, North Bay
S Byers
705-476-3128
832 John St, North Bay